# Digest Scheduling Env Vars

Welcome to the Pelicanloop team! Our batch email digests are scheduled by the Morrowmail worker, and almost everything about it is tuned through environment variables. `DIGEST_CRON` controls the send window (default is 07:00 in the tenant's timezone), and `DIGEST_BATCH_SIZE` caps each run at 500 messages unless you bump it. Don't set it above 2000 or the relay gets grumpy. The worker also needs to authenticate with the relay, so your local env file should include this line:

sealed setting: ARCHIVE_KEY3=8d0

## Formula sandbox tuning

User-supplied formulas in Gridmoor execute inside a restricted interpreter with hard ceilings on time, memory, and call depth. Reviewers should confirm any change to these ceilings is justified in the PR description, since raising them widens the abuse surface. Defaults were chosen from production traces. The current limits are as follows.

limits module of tafog-fawip:
WEIGHTS = {
    "julix": 57,
    "lamys": 992,
    "kasvan": 209,
    "quenok": 750,
    "alddor": 259,
    "oliath": 1009,
    "wenix": 815,
}

Summary for sales leads. The Bramlow Partner Network closed H1 at 92% of revenue target. Thirty-one active resellers; nine added, four lapsed. Average deal size up 11%, driven by the Orveta bundle. Margin erosion from tier-two discounting remains the main concern: blended margin fell 2.3 points. Rebate accruals tracked within tolerance. Actions: tighten discount approvals above 15%, retire the legacy starter tier, accelerate certification in the Dunmere territory. Leadership's commercial direction for H2 is summarised in the note below.

confidential, kagup-bafog: Fraaxax Group is in early talks to buy Soroxox Group for about $343.8 million. The Olidor launch date is June 14, and nothing goes to the press before then. Legal wants the Aldmirek Logistics term sheet signed before July 23.

**Mgmt Meeting Minutes — Retiring the Brightline Range**

Quick recap for sales leads at Fenholt Supplies: we agreed to retire the Brightline fixture range by year-end. Remaining stock moves to clearance pricing next month, and accounts on standing orders get migrated to the Lumetta range. Trade-in incentives were approved in principle. The confidential note on next steps sits just below.

board note of bajof-bajeg: The pricing group signed off on a budget of $13.4 million for Project Sildor. The renewal with Lamixek Holdings closes at $48.9 million a year, 49 percent above the last contract.